Output 58affed5cd648db60b6815f9d72d0ee9d2d00765f26981d4b45358425df04e47:109

value
382696
script pubkey
OP_0 OP_PUSHBYTES_20 7203a15fde0c19677f0498212eeed9be6605a050
address
bc1qwgp6zh77psvkwlcynqsjamkehenqtgzspzgphv
transaction
58affed5cd648db60b6815f9d72d0ee9d2d00765f26981d4b45358425df04e47
confirmations
125689
spent
true